In brief: Paraguay, Uruguay, Argentina

Paraguay: President Horacio Cartes has formally inaugurated a new US$14m electricity substation of the state-owned electricity firm, Ande, in the city of Fernando de la Mora, Central department. Cartes said that the new substation and its underground transmission line linking it to the nearby city of San Lorenzo, also in Central department, will benefit 85,000 electricity consumers and ensure that these don’t have to suffer any more power blackouts during peak consumption periods. This is the first Ande electricity substation to be built since 2005.
